The journey from a hopeful molecule in a lab to a life -saving medication on a pharmacy shelf is a long, rigorous process. Before a drug ever reaches large-scale efficacy testing, it must navigate the highly specialized Phase Zero Of Clinical Trial, also known as exploratory IND (Investigational New Drug) studies. This critical stage serves as the porter for pharmaceutic maturation, allowing researcher to remark how a drug behaves in the human body without exposing participants to toxic doses. By prioritizing human micro-dosing early in the line, scientist can improve allocate imagination, potentially save years of development clip while significantly cut the risk associate with traditional drug uncovering.

The Evolution and Significance of Exploratory Trials

Historically, drug development get from a eminent attrition pace, where many compound failed solely after expensive and lengthy Phase I run. The introduction of the Phase Zero Of Clinical Trial paradigm shifted this dynamic. Unlike standard Phase I work that search the Maximum Tolerated Dose (MTD), these early studies use sub-therapeutic doses - doses so minor they are unlikely to cause a pharmacologic effect but are sufficient to forgather pharmacokinetic information.

Key Objectives of Phase Zero

  • Pharmacokinetics (PK): Determining how the human body absorbs, distributes, metabolizes, and egest the investigational merchandise.
  • Pharmacodynamics (PD): Evaluating how the drug interacts with its target receptors in the body, still at very low density.
  • Early Failure Identification: Stop the development of compounds that evidence piteous bioavailability or unexpected metabolic profiles early on.
  • Dose Selection Optimization: Providing foundational data to contrive more accurate and safer doses for subsequent Phase I testing.

Methodology and Participant Safety

The principal concern in any clinical research is guard. Because these trial involve human, they are rigorously influence and supervise. The low vd utilized - typically 1/100th of the dose forecast to be harmful in animal models - ensures that participants are not pose at substantial aesculapian risk. These trial are broadly conducted with a very little cohort, usually consist of few than 15 participant.

Regulatory Framework and Ethical Considerations

Regulative body acknowledge these explorative studies as a life-sustaining instrument for efficiency. However, the honourable requirements remain stringent. Because there is no outlook of unmediated therapeutic benefit for the player, the burden of proof regarding safety remainder heavily on the presymptomatic animal studies performed beforehand. Investigator must establish that the compound is unbelievable to induce adverse outcome yet if the micro-dose figuring has a pocket-size margin of error.

The Benefits for Pharmaceutical Innovation

By incorporate this stage into the standard research timeline, pharmaceutic companies can effectively crop their portfolio. This "fail fast" mentality ascertain that researchers do not waste clip and capital on compound that will inevitably fail due to poor human metabolism or uneffective bandaging at the molecular site of action. This efficiency contributes to a more sustainable model of drug growth where innovation is honor by speed and precision.
